diff options
Diffstat (limited to 'source-builder/sb-check')
-rwxr-xr-x | source-builder/sb-check | 24 |
1 files changed, 14 insertions, 10 deletions
diff --git a/source-builder/sb-check b/source-builder/sb-check index b092697..b75767e 100755 --- a/source-builder/sb-check +++ b/source-builder/sb-check @@ -1,7 +1,7 @@ -#! /bin/sh +#! /usr/bin/env python # # RTEMS Tools Project (http://www.rtems.org/) -# Copyright 2018 Chris Johns (chrisj@rtems.org) +# Copyright 2010-2012 Chris Johns (chrisj@rtems.org) # All rights reserved. # # This file is part of the RTEMS Tools package in 'rtems-tools'. @@ -17,11 +17,15 @@ # WHATSOEVER RESULTING FROM LOSS OF USE, DATA OR PROFITS, WHETHER IN AN # 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F # O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E. -# -set -e -base=$(dirname $0) -PYTHON_CMD=${base}/sb/cmd-check.py -if test -f ${base}/sb/python-wrapper.sh; then - . ${base}/sb/python-wrapper.sh -fi -echo "error: python wrapper not found" + +from __future__ import print_function + +import sb.check + +try: + import sb.check + sb.check.run() +except ImportError: + import sys + print("Incorrect Source Builder installation", file = sys.stderr) + sys.exit(1) |